Perhaps consider adding grain. A ton of silage contains approx 8 bu of grain. Thus you will need approx 5# of silage to increase grain in ration 1#. The issue with silage is they fill up before the energy needs are met. IMO a 5 gallon bucket of shell corn or DDG (25-30#) morning and night would have been more beneficial than the extra silage. If they lost weight they were not able to consume enough volume to satisfy their energy needs.

Here is an article from UNL. Granted it is for beef cows, the situation is similar to bred heifers.
